Output 9fb60f23ef57c0bd2ecae7ceb475ca7afe90b6eb4fa95c12eaa9d72c8d68b6bd:0

value
345162
script pubkey
OP_0 OP_PUSHBYTES_20 efc2c6a6f332c0f2d01b066feda07573ae880e24
address
bc1qalpvdfhnxtq095qmqeh7mgr4wwhgsr3yk85yq5
transaction
9fb60f23ef57c0bd2ecae7ceb475ca7afe90b6eb4fa95c12eaa9d72c8d68b6bd
confirmations
2882
spent
true